Transaction d511751cc7c50b58cd0f1acefe72665de614aad4bbf52754682f5d764f74c943
1 Input
1 Output
-
d511751cc7c50b58cd0f1acefe72665de614aad4bbf52754682f5d764f74c943:0
- value
- 2044657
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b7d7bc698e9fdb548ca831129c272e68ed422d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Tu8htWooZXgo9HEVVjresdFB8FXpsQCR